[u] and [uw]
|
[u]
|
[u] is articulated with the back of the tongue raised close to
the roof of the mouth. The lips are a little rounded.
|
 |
|
[uw]
|
The articulation of [uw] is similar to that of [uw], except that
the lips are closer together and more rounded, as if whistling.
The vowel is diphthongized.
